An Executive Certificate in Intersectional Gender Studies is increasingly significant in today's UK market. Businesses are facing growing pressure to address gender inequality and promote diversity and inclusion. According to a 2023 report by the Fawcett Society, only 33% of FTSE 100 board positions are held by women, highlighting a significant gender imbalance at the highest levels of UK organizations. This certificate equips professionals with the critical skills to navigate complex gender dynamics in the workplace, fostering a more inclusive and equitable environment. Understanding intersectionality—the interconnected nature of social categorizations such as race, class, and gender—is crucial for effectively tackling inequalities and building truly diverse teams. This specialized training allows executives to implement effective D&I strategies, enhancing employee wellbeing and boosting organisational performance. The demand for professionals with expertise in this area is steadily rising, making this certificate a valuable asset for career advancement.
